* Manage search components in SharePoint Server 2013
Start a search service instance on a server
Retrieve the active search topology
Clone the active search topology
Add a search component
Remove a search component
Move a search component
Activate a search topology
* To make any changes to the search topology in a search installation that has items in the search index, you first have to create a new topology object. You modify this new topology object, a clone of the active topology, by adding or removing search components. After you have made the changes to the clone topology object, you make the clone the active topology.
